Tuna (or Chicken) Casserole

 Contributed by Connie Lancaster
I found this recipe online.  It was touted as "comfort food" with some healthy changes.  I felt more changes were needed, but I decided to take on the challenge.  I don't like tuna, so I used canned chicken.  I added my changes in parenthesis.

Ingredients

    * 1/2 cup butter, divided  (1/4 CUP OLIVE OIL)
    * 1 (8 ounce) package uncooked medium egg noodles (WHEAT)
    * 1/2 medium onion, finely chopped
    * 1 stalk celery, finely chopped
    * 1 clove garlic, minced
    * 8 ounces button mushrooms, sliced
    * 1/4 cup all-purpose flour (WHEAT)
    * 2 cups milk (SKIM)
    * salt and pepper to taste
    * 2 (6 ounce) cans tuna, drained and flaked  (1 can white chicken meat)
    * 1 cup frozen peas, thawed
    * 3 tablespoons bread crumbs (WHEAT)
    * 2 tablespoons butter, melted (OLIVE OIL)
    * 1 cup shredded Cheddar cheese  (SKIM MOZZARELLA)

Directions

  1. Preheat oven to 375 degrees F (190 degrees C).
  2. Bring a large pot of lightly salted water to a boil. Add egg noodles, cook for 8 to 10 minutes, until al dente, and drain.
  3. Melt 1 tablespoon olive oil in a skillet over medium-low heat. Stir in the onion, celery, and garlic, and cook 5 minutes, until tender. Increase heat to medium-high, and mix in mushrooms. Continue to cook and stir 5 minutes, or until most of the liquid has evaporated.
  4. Melt 4 tablespoons olive oil in a medium saucepan, and whisk in flour until smooth. Gradually whisk in milk, and continue cooking 5 minutes, until sauce is smooth and slightly thickened. Season with salt and pepper. Stir in tuna (or chicken), peas, mushroom mixture, and cooked noodles. Transfer to the baking dish. Sprinkle a small amount of olive oil with bread crumbs, and sprinkle over the casserole. Top with cheese.
  5. Bake 25 minutes in the preheated oven, or until bubbly and lightly browned.
